President J.A.Kufuor of Ghana has been described as a world leader by the French Foreign Minister, Mr. Dominic de Villepin. “Your President is not only seen as a President of Ghana or Africa, but as a world leader, because his views are highly respected by other world leaders”, he said.
Mr. de Villepin said this at a joint-press conference with his Ghanaian counterpart, Hon. Nana A. Akufo-Addo, in Accra after his two-day working visit to Ghana over the weekend.
Mr. de Villepin said the capacity of Ghana to take up the responsibility to move Africa on the path of democratisation and peace is commendable.
Responding to a question as to whether the French President, Jacques Chirac has the intention of visiting Ghana, at least once in his life, the Minister said, the quality leadership of President Kufuor, justifies the consolidation of relationship between the two countries at that high level. “And discussions are going on for that consideration”, he said.
President Kufuor, on the other hand had already visited France twice since he became President of Ghana in 2001. He first went to Paris in November 2001 as well as in January 2003 when he attended the conference of Heads of States of Africa on the Ivorian crisis.
